What Happened To TV Doc Michael Mosley? How Heat Can Be Deadly
TV doctor Michael Mosley went for a walk while holidaying in Greece recently, the region currently experiencing a heatwave, with temperatures in the high 30's and low 40's. Sadly, Dr Mosley did not return from that walk and his body was found days later. His death, reportedly due to the extreme heat. In this episode of The Quicky, we take a look at the effects of heat on the human body and how we can avoid putting ourselves at risk. 4 Hostages, 270 Lives, The Cost Of Hostage Rescue
On Saturday, four Israeli hostages were freed from inside Gaza. While the families of the rescues hostages are relieved to have their loved ones home again, the lives lost in the mission, involving Israeli Elite Special Forces Soldiers, shows the price innocent Palestinian civilians will continue to pay in this war. In this episode of The Quicky, we take a look at what happened, the intricacies of hostage rescues in this conflict and the price that's being paid in order to rescue them. The Birth Trauma Report: Are We Finally Listening To Mothers?
The NSW Birth Trauma Inquiry recently released their report after six hearings and an unprecedented 4000 submissions. It was tagged as the Me Too Movement for women who have suffered trauma during childbirth. The report gave 43 recommendations. But will they be enough?
